Misioka Maluapapa Timoteo (born 26 November 1988) is a Samoan former international rugby union player. [1]
A forward, Timoteo could play a variety of positions in the scrum and was capped six times for Samoa, including matches against France and Italy on their 2009 end-of-year tour to Europe. [2]
Timoteo won a Polish championship with Lechia Gdańsk in 2012–13 and was named "Best on Ground" in South Darwin's 2016 premiership win. [3] [4] He also played Queensland first-grade rugby for Wests and with Brisbane City in the National Rugby Championship. [5]
